| using System; |
| using System.Collections.Generic; |
| using System.Collections.ObjectModel; |
| using System.Reflection; |
| using Moq; |
| using NUnit.Framework; |
| |
| namespace OpenQA.Selenium.Support.UI; |
| |
| [TestFixture] |
| public class SelectTests |
| { |
| private Mock<IWebElement> webElement; |
| |
| [SetUp] |
| public void SetUp() |
| { |
| webElement = new Mock<IWebElement>(); |
| } |
| |
| [Test] |
| public void ThrowUnexpectedTagNameExceptionWhenNotSelectTag() |
| { |
| webElement.SetupGet<string>(_ => _.TagName).Returns("form"); |
| Assert.That( |
| () => new SelectElement(webElement.Object), |
| Throws.TypeOf<UnexpectedTagNameException>()); |
| } |
| |
| [Test] |
| public void CanCreateNewInstanceOfSelectWithNormalSelectElement() |
| { |
| webElement.SetupGet<string>(_ => _.TagName).Returns("select"); |
| webElement.Setup(_ => _.GetAttribute(It.Is<string>(x => x == "multiple"))).Returns((string)null); |
| |
| Assert.That(new SelectElement(webElement.Object).IsMultiple, Is.False); |
| } |
| |
| [Test] |
| public void CanCreateNewInstanceOfSelectWithMultipleSelectElement() |
| { |
| webElement.SetupGet<string>(_ => _.TagName).Returns("select"); |
| webElement.Setup(_ => _.GetAttribute(It.Is<string>(x => x == "multiple"))).Returns("true"); |
| |
| Assert.That(new SelectElement(webElement.Object).IsMultiple, Is.True); |
| } |
| |
| [Test] |
| public void CanGetListOfOptions() |
| { |
| IList<IWebElement> options = new List<IWebElement>(); |
| webElement.SetupGet<string>(_ => _.TagName).Returns("select"); |
| webElement.Setup(_ => _.GetAttribute(It.Is<string>(x => x == "multiple"))).Returns("true"); |
| webElement.Setup(_ => _.FindElements(It.IsAny<By>())).Returns(new ReadOnlyCollection<IWebElement>(options)); |
| |
| Assert.That(new SelectElement(webElement.Object).Options, Is.EqualTo(options)); |
| } |
| |
| [Test] |
| public void CanGetSingleSelectedOption() |
| { |
| Mock<IWebElement> selected = new Mock<IWebElement>(); |
| Mock<IWebElement> notSelected = new Mock<IWebElement>(); |
| IList<IWebElement> options = new List<IWebElement>(); |
| options.Add(notSelected.Object); |
| options.Add(selected.Object); |
| |
| webElement.SetupGet<string>(_ => _.TagName).Returns("select"); |
| webElement.Setup(_ => _.GetAttribute(It.Is<string>(x => x == "multiple"))).Returns("true"); |
| notSelected.SetupGet<bool>(_ => _.Selected).Returns(false); |
| selected.SetupGet<bool>(_ => _.Selected).Returns(true); |
| webElement.Setup(_ => _.FindElements(It.IsAny<By>())).Returns(new ReadOnlyCollection<IWebElement>(options)).Verifiable(); |
| |
| IWebElement option = new SelectElement(webElement.Object).SelectedOption; |
| Assert.That(option, Is.EqualTo(selected.Object)); |
| notSelected.Verify(_ => _.Selected, Times.Once); |
| selected.Verify(_ => _.Selected, Times.Once); |
| webElement.Verify(); |
| } |
| |
| [Test] |
| public void CanGetAllSelectedOptions() |
| { |
| Mock<IWebElement> selected = new Mock<IWebElement>(); |
| Mock<IWebElement> notSelected = new Mock<IWebElement>(); |
| IList<IWebElement> options = new List<IWebElement>(); |
| options.Add(selected.Object); |
| options.Add(notSelected.Object); |
| |
| webElement.SetupGet<string>(_ => _.TagName).Returns("select"); |
| webElement.Setup(_ => _.GetAttribute(It.Is<string>(x => x == "multiple"))).Returns("true"); |
| notSelected.SetupGet<bool>(_ => _.Selected).Returns(false); |
| selected.SetupGet<bool>(_ => _.Selected).Returns(true); |
| webElement.Setup(_ => _.FindElements(It.IsAny<By>())).Returns(new ReadOnlyCollection<IWebElement>(options)).Verifiable(); |
| |
| IList<IWebElement> returnedOption = new SelectElement(webElement.Object).AllSelectedOptions; |
| Assert.That(returnedOption, Has.Count.EqualTo(1)); |
| Assert.That(returnedOption[0], Is.EqualTo(selected.Object)); |
| notSelected.Verify(_ => _.Selected, Times.Once); |
| selected.Verify(_ => _.Selected, Times.Once); |
| webElement.Verify(); |
| } |
| |
| [Test] |
| public void CanSetSingleOptionSelectedByText() |
| { |
| Mock<IWebElement> option1 = new Mock<IWebElement>(); |
| IList<IWebElement> options = new List<IWebElement>(); |
| options.Add(option1.Object); |
| |
| webElement.SetupGet<string>(_ => _.TagName).Returns("select"); |
| webElement.Setup(_ => _.GetAttribute(It.Is<string>(x => x == "multiple"))).Returns("true"); |

| [Test] |
| public void ShouldConvertAnUnquotedStringIntoOneWithQuotes() |
| { |
| string result = EscapeQuotes("foo"); |
| |
| Assert.That(result, Is.EqualTo("\"foo\"")); |
| } |
| |
| [Test] |
| public void ShouldConvertAStringWithATickIntoOneWithQuotes() |
| { |
| string result = EscapeQuotes("f'oo"); |
| |
| Assert.That(result, Is.EqualTo("\"f'oo\"")); |
| } |
| |
| [Test] |
| public void ShouldConvertAStringWithAQuotIntoOneWithTicks() |
| { |
| string result = EscapeQuotes("f\"oo"); |
| |
| Assert.That(result, Is.EqualTo("'f\"oo'")); |
| } |
| |
| [Test] |
| public void ShouldProvideConcatenatedStringsWhenStringToEscapeContainsTicksAndQuotes() |
| { |
| string result = EscapeQuotes("f\"o'o"); |
| |
| Assert.That(result, Is.EqualTo("concat(\"f\", '\"', \"o'o\")")); |
| } |
| |
| /** |
| * Tests that escapeQuotes returns concatenated strings when the given |
| * string contains a tick and and ends with a quote. |
| */ |
| [Test] |
| public void ShouldProvideConcatenatedStringsWhenStringEndsWithQuote() |
| { |
| string result = EscapeQuotes("Bar \"Rock'n'Roll\""); |
| |
| Assert.That(result, Is.EqualTo("concat(\"Bar \", '\"', \"Rock'n'Roll\", '\"')")); |
| } |
| |
| private string EscapeQuotes(string toEscape) |
| { |
| Type selectElementType = typeof(SelectElement); |
| MethodInfo escapeQuotesMethod = selectElementType.GetMethod("EscapeQuotes", BindingFlags.Static | BindingFlags.NonPublic); |
| string result = escapeQuotesMethod.Invoke(null, new object[] { toEscape }).ToString(); |
| return result; |
| } |
| } |
